Yo Philly! This could be tough one. 🥔 Three area businesses are battling it out to be the top Philly-flavored potato chip.
-"Corropolese Bakery has been a community staple since 1924. Now in its fourth generation of family ownership, their signature tomato pie attracts customers from all over the Philly area. The flavors of delicately sweet tomato sauce and Romano cheese combined with our hearty potato chips provide a snack that’s hard to put down."-"Best known for their award-winning Roast Pork Sandwich, each sandwich is a labor of love for the people of Philadelphia.
The winners were narrowed from more than 1,500 flavor ideas"that included sweet flavors like cannoli and donut, and savory flavors like pierogi and taco," Herr's said. Judges who whittled down the field included Top Chef Jen Carroll of Spice Finch and Herr’s Chairman and CEO, Ed Herr.
